Lausitzring Qualifying results:

1 - Spengler B. BMW Team Schnitzer BMW Bank M3 DTM 1:18.777
2 - Farfus A. BMW Team RBM Castrol EDGE BMW M3 DTM 1:18.815
3 - Paffett G. THOMAS SABO Mercedes AMG THOMAS SABO Mercedes AMG C-Coupé 1:18.820
4 - Rockenfeller M. Audi Sport Team Phoenix Schaeffler Audi A5 DTM 1:19.206
5 - Mortara E. Audi Sport Team Rosberg Playboy Audi A5 DTM 1:18.374
6 - Green J. Mercedes AMG Mercedes AMG C-Coupé 1:18.461
7 - Tomczyk M. BMW Team RMG BMW M Performance Zubehör M3 DTM 1:18.490
8 - Ekström M. Audi Sport Team Abt Sportsline Red Bull Audi A5 DTM 1:18.569
9 - Molina M. Audi Sport Team Phoenix Red Bull Audi A5 DTM 1:18.667
10 - Tambay A. Audi Sport Team Abt Audi ultra A5 DTM 1:18.686
11 - Albuquerque F. Audi Sport Team Rosberg TV Movie Audi A5 DTM 1:18.749
12 - Scheider T. Audi Sport Team Abt Sportsline AUTO TEST Audi A5 DTM 1:18.758
13 - Priaulx A. BMW Team RBM Crowne Plaza Hotels BMW M3 DTM 1:18.771
14 - Hand J. BMW Team RMG SAMSUNG BMW M3 DTM 1:18.817
15 - Wickens R. stern Mercedes AMG stern Mercedes AMG C-Coupé 1:18.840
16 - Vietoris C. Mercedes-Benz Bank AMG Mercedes-Benz Bank AMG C-Coupé 1:18.862
17 - Schumacher R. Mercedes AMG Mercedes AMG C-Coupé 1:19.506
18 - Merhi R. Junge Sterne Mercedes AMG Junge Sterne Mercedes AMG C-Coupé 1:19.557
19 - Wolff S. TV SPIELFILM Mercedes AMG TV SPIELFILM Mercedes AMG C-Coupé 1:19.584
20 - Coulthard D. DHL Paket Mercedes AMG DHL Paket Mercedes AMG C-Coupé 1:19.672
21 - Werner D. BMW Team Schnitzer E-POSTBRIEF BMW M3 DTM 1:19.737
22 - Frey R. Audi Sport Team Abt E-POSTBRIEF Audi A5 DTM 1:20.415
